21WX-3084: Business Tax Update with Steve Dilley (Webinar)

A discussion of the numerous 2020/2021 tax legislation impacting business taxpayers, with a focus on important provisions, rules and concepts. This course is designed to provide the practitioner with the latest tax developments in order to prepare for the upcoming tax preparation season. Major subjects

  • "
  • NEW 2021 tax legislation and developments impacting business taxpayers, including any COVID-19 related developments
  • Depreciation and capitalization review and update
  • 2021 corporate tax rate
  • Excess business losses
  • Section 199A review and update
  • Business meals, entertainment and travel expense reporting
  • Key rulings, regulations and cases impacting business taxpayers
